en: |
|
|
Ant. Well done, thou good and faithful servant * thou hast been faithful over a few things, I will make thee ruler over many things, saith the Lord.
|
|
V. The Lord led the just through the right ways:
|
|
R. And showed him the kingdom of God.
|
|
Let us pray.
|
|
Almighty and everlasting God, Who hast granted unto the Slavic peoples the
|
|
knowledge of thy Name through the mean of thy blessed Confessors and Bishops
|
|
Cyril and Methodius, grant that we, who here keep gladly the festival of the
|
|
same thy Saints, may hereafter be gathered unto their company.
|
|
Through Jesus Christ, thy Son our Lord, Who liveth and reigneth with thee, in the
|
|
unity of the Holy Ghost, God, world without end.
|
|
R. Amen.
